The Marking Rules established by the United States are set forth in 19 CFR Part 102 which are used to determine the country of origin. The Marking Rules are distinct from the rules of origin that are used to determine whether a good is originating under Article 401 of the Agreement. See more For goods made in one country with no foreign inputs, determination of the country of origin is easy--it is the country of production.
